I've been playing Genshin Impact since early December. It's a freemium open-world action RPG that takes a lot of cues from Zelda BotW. Of course, once you get into the game, it's quite different and in some ways, even better. The graphic and art style is very nice especially the environment and bgm. This is definitely a game where you might want to just take your time and just walk around in. You can run, swim, climb and even glide all around the world of Teyvat. The characters and storyline definitely have a heavy anime influence on them. That can be a plus or minus depending on your taste. Probably the best thing about this game is that you can play on your phone outdoors and then continue the game on your PC at home; the only thing you need is internet access. Either way, won't hurt to try it out; it is free after all. It's available for PC, Android, iOS, and PS4. Just make sure you have at least a mid-tier device that can run modern stuff like LoL, Fortnight, and Overwatch and you should be good to go.

The big highlight for me though was scoring a Nerf Rival Prometheus from Tuesday Morning of all places for just $50. In a nutshell, the Prometheus is a Nerf Rival version of a chaingun. It holds over 250 rounds of ammo and rapid fires them at roughly 6-8 shots a second on full auto. It's by far the most powerful Nerf Rival on the market as it tops all the other unmodified guns in both speed and power. I could not wipe out the wide grin I have on my face every time I fire that thing. Original MSRP is $200 and even in the secondary market, it runs over $100 used so I was very lucky to find mine new. If you can get this gun for $100 even, it is 100 percent worth it; that's how much fun it is.

ComiPo and other comic creating software

I tried out the ComiPo trial download. You can find more details about ComiPo at their website.

Test comic

A test comic using the Comipo software. Cool stuff is that you can drag & drop all sorts of special effects and backgrounds. The biggest disappointment OTOH is that it lacks basic text formatting features such as center justification and word wrap. Funny thing is it's easy to see why as Japanese tend to use just a single style of justification and because of that don't use word wrap either so the concepts are foreign to them. Another disappointment is they don't make all the features available such as importing your own pictures which is rather important. I want to see how that works out before I throw down any wad of cash and they pretty much screwed that up.

I've also tried Comic Life and Comic Life 2. Comic Life I was kinda disappointed with because all it does is help with text balloons and panel layouts. CL has no special effects function whatsoever so I'd still be reliant on GIMP for the fancy stuff. CL2 is a mass disappointment because it runs SLOW. I'm surprised I was able to get anything done, it was that bad. The first CL runs circles around CL2.

All that's left for me to try is Comic Creator, a software I found at the local Microcenter. It seems to feature what I'm looking for which is a way to quickly create text balloons and add special effects. We'll see how that works out.
